The Grownup ADHD Knowledge: Far more Than Just Focus Troubles

Grownup ADHD manifests far over and above the stereotypical picture of a hyperactive boy or girl not able to sit nonetheless in school. The problem offers as a complex constellation of indications that will profoundly impact every single element of an adult's lifetime. Inattention might surface as Persistent disorganization, problem completing assignments, or an incapacity to maintain emphasis all through conversations. Grown ups with ADHD normally describe sensation mentally "foggy" or as if their views are continuously racing with no way.

Hyperactivity in adults normally evolves into inside restlessness—a persistent emotion of becoming "wound up" or not able to take it easy. This could manifest as fidgeting, problems sitting by way of videos or conferences, or a compulsive require to stay occupied. In the meantime, impulsivity may result in hasty conclusion-making, interrupting Other individuals, or producing purchases with no contemplating monetary effects.

Government working deficits depict perhaps the most tough facet of adult ADHD. These people struggle with time management, prioritization, and psychological regulation. They could procrastinate on significant jobs when hyperfocusing on a lot less important functions, making a cycle of pressure and underachievement that will persist For a long time.

The Myth of Outgrowing ADHD

Probably the most dangerous misconceptions about ADHD is usually that it's a childhood situation that people today will Obviously outgrow. This belief helps prevent quite a few Grownups from seeking the assistance they desperately require. Though hyperactivity signs or symptoms could become a lot less apparent with age, the Main problems of inattention, impulsivity, and govt dysfunction typically persist and can even intensify as adult tasks enhance.

The idea that one can simply just "consider harder" or produce better willpower to beat ADHD indicators is don't just incorrect but hazardous. ADHD is a neurodevelopmental problem with apparent biological underpinnings, which include variations in Mind composition and neurotransmitter perform. Telling another person with ADHD to easily target superior is comparable to telling an individual with diabetic issues to just generate additional insulin through dedication.

Devoid of proper diagnosis and treatment method, ADHD signs or symptoms can worsen over time as existence calls for maximize. The coping strategies that could have worked in childhood or early adulthood typically establish insufficient when confronted with vocation advancement, marriage, parenting, as well as other intricate adult obligations.

The Unsafe Route of Self-Medication

Confronted with persistent signs or symptoms and missing right analysis, quite a few Older people with ADHD transform to self-medication as a method to deal with their complications. Alcohol becomes a common night ritual to silent racing feelings and lower hyperactivity. Stimulants like caffeine or maybe illicit substances can be applied to boost emphasis and productiveness in the course of perform hours.

This self-medication sample is especially unsafe due to the fact it provides temporary aid when generating extended-term problems. Alcoholic beverages may possibly originally help with slumber and stress, nevertheless it ultimately disrupts slumber good quality and can result in dependency. Excessive caffeine consumption can improve anxiety and disrupt snooze patterns, exacerbating ADHD indications.

Some men and women uncover that sure recreational drugs briefly enhance their aim or mood, bringing about risky experimentation with substances which can have critical lawful and overall health consequences. The momentary relief supplied by these substances makes a Wrong sense that the situation is solved, stopping persons from searching for right Expert cure.

Self-medication methods inevitably fall short mainly because they Never tackle the fundamental neurological distinctions that bring about ADHD symptoms. Alternatively, they normally produce added complications whilst making it possible for the Main issues to persist and possibly worsen.

The Treatment method Landscape: Hope and Risk

The landscape of ADHD treatment provides real hope for Grown ups combating this ailment. Proof-based treatment options incorporate FDA-permitted remedies that can considerably enhance focus, lessen impulsivity, and enrich government operating. These prescription drugs, when adequately prescribed and monitored, is often lifetime-transforming For lots of people today.

Behavioral interventions and coaching may also help Older people acquire realistic tactics for controlling time, organizing tasks, and improving interactions. Cognitive-behavioral therapy addresses the detrimental considered designs and emotional challenges That always accompany yrs of fighting undiagnosed ADHD.

Life style modifications, like typical physical exercise, enhanced snooze hygiene, and tension administration approaches, can provide additional symptom aid and increase General Standard of living. A lot of adults notice that knowledge their ADHD aids them make career possibilities and existence decisions that align with their strengths and accommodate their troubles.

The Neuropsychological Assessment: The Necessary First Step

These remedy possibilities begin website with one critical step: acquiring an extensive neuropsychological assessment from an experienced Skilled. Neuropsychological psychologists have specialized education in understanding the connection between brain purpose and behavior, generating them uniquely qualified to diagnose ADHD in Grownups.

A radical evaluation goes much outside of simple symptom checklists. It involves in-depth developmental background, detailed cognitive tests, and evaluation of how signs impression every day working. This method can differentiate ADHD from other disorders that may present with related indications, like nervousness Conditions, despair, or learning disabilities.

The neuropsychological assessment offers a roadmap for treatment method, determining precise strengths and weaknesses that can manual intervention methods.
